High-Performance Mechanical Branch Connector
This mechanical branch connector is engineered for reliable intermediate branch connections in medium voltage power systems. It is compatible with copper, aluminum, and aluminum alloy cables, offering a versatile solution for various electrical infrastructure needs. Designed for efficiency, the connector features torque-controlled shear head bolts that eliminate the need for specialized crimping tools, ensuring a stable and damage-free installation.

Key Installation Features
- Oil blocking structure
- Torque controlled shear head bolts
- Prefilled with jointing compound
- No crimping tools required (uses socket spanner or wrench)
- Threaded inner surface for superior performance

Model GLLB70-240/70-240-2/6 Specifications
| Parameter | Value |
|---|---|
| Conductor Size (mm²) | 70-240 |
| Shear-off Torque (N.m) | 36 |
| Number of Bolts | 6 |
| Wrench Size | 19 |
